2 Drive the water treatment industry to achieve health popularization

In developed countries in Europe and America, the use of chlorine dioxide for the regulation of chlorite metabolites in their public water supply systems has become so strict that the residual tolerance is only limited to 0.8mg/L. This level of attention comes from the strong adaptability of chlorine dioxide, which not only has the powerful ability to control bacteria, viruses, and biofilms, but also has the characteristics of removing pigments, odors, and iron and manganese ions from water, balancing disinfection and water quality optimization. This precisely reflects the core position of chlorine dioxide in municipal water supply disinfection.

Especially in terms of technical effectiveness, the research report published in "Water Purification Technology" (one of the authoritative technical journals in China) clearly shows that disinfection with only 0.3mg/L chlorine dioxide for 30 minutes can achieve a sterilization rate of up to 99%, and the algae removal rate in the pre oxidation stage can reach over 90%, which is much better than the 97% of sodium hypochlorite under the same conditions. More importantly, chlorine dioxide can maintain a certain effective concentration at the end or dead corners of the pipeline network, and is not easily affected by the acidity or alkalinity of water quality. It can easily adapt to the complex and changing disinfection environment of water quality, which is a significant advantage.

3 Interpretation of the advantages of chlorine dioxide disinfectant

Compared to traditional chlorine based disinfectants such as sodium hypochlorite, the sterilization mechanism of chlorine dioxide is that it is more soluble in water and less prone to hydrolysis reactions. By oxidizing tyrosine and tryptophan in the cell wall, it breaks down the biofilm barrier and quickly inactivates enzyme proteins, directly blocking microbial metabolism to complete sterilization work. Compared to sodium hypochlorite, this has a more direct hydrolysis property, stronger targeting ability, and faster reaction rate.

In addition, in terms of environmental dependence, chlorine dioxide can maintain its original strong oxidative activity and cell penetration over a wide pH range (pH3-10), which easily defeats sodium hypochlorite that can only emphasize strict limits on the pH range of the solution (pH5.5-7.0), thereby reducing the complexity of process preparation and operating costs.

Not only that, especially in the processing of fresh cut fruits and vegetables, poultry and seafood, chlorine dioxide disinfectant does not produce other chlorine conversion residues on the surface of the food, and has good process adaptability. Moreover, the disinfection effect is long-lasting and beneficial for extending the shelf life. In addition, chlorine dioxide is different from disinfectants such as sodium hypochlorite or peracetic acid. It not only kills quickly, but also does not leave irritating odors. It does not cause strong corrosive secondary damage to metal equipment, and has a relatively high compatibility and environmental friendliness for equipment operation. Recently, in China, the "Hygienic Standards for Secondary Water Supply Facilities" (GB17051-2025), which will be officially implemented on June 1st, will include chlorite, a byproduct of chlorine dioxide disinfection, as a mandatory test indicator. The number of testing items will increase from 8 to 13. This means that the standardization of hygiene administrative licensing for water related products continues to be strict, which is not only a compliance promotion for chlorine dioxide, but also a differentiation of the advantages of chlorine dioxide while ensuring product quality.
